The Sandalwood Market grew from USD 442.58 million in 2024 to USD 470.72 million in 2025. It is expected to continue growing at a CAGR of 6.46%, reaching USD 644.57 million by 2030. Speak directly to the analyst to clarify any post sales queries you may have.
Unlocking the Essence of Sandalwood in Contemporary Markets
Sandalwood occupies a unique intersection of sensory allure and cultural significance, serving as a cornerstone for industries ranging from perfumery to wellness. Its warm, woody aroma and purported therapeutic benefits have fostered enduring demand across global markets. Historically prized for luxury applications, sandalwood derivatives now underpin diverse consumer offerings, including skincare, homecare, and culinary infusions, reflecting the ingredient’s evolving versatility.As the market landscape becomes increasingly complex, industry stakeholders must navigate shifting regulatory regimes, sustainability imperatives, and emerging technological innovations. These forces are reshaping how sandalwood is sourced, processed, and marketed. At the same time, heightened consumer awareness of ethical harvesting in plantation contexts and interest in synthetic biosourcing techniques have introduced new dimensions to supply chain strategy.

Deciphering Market Dynamics through Product, Grade, Use and Distribution Profiles
Analyzing the market through the product form lens reveals diverse demand drivers. Chips remain highly valued by artisanal perfumers and traditional practitioners, while concentrated extracts attract formulators seeking potent aromatic delivery. Essential oils command strong interest in therapeutic and cosmetic applications, and superfine powders offer versatility for homecare and culinary infusions.Quality grade segmentation highlights a clear dichotomy: naturally sourced sandalwood appeals to luxury and heritage cohorts that prioritize provenance, whereas synthetic equivalents provide consistency and cost-effectiveness for large-scale manufacturing. This balance between artisanal authenticity and industrial scalability shapes brand positioning and pricing strategies across the market.
End use segmentation underscores the ingredient’s broad reach. In aromatherapy, sandalwood oils bolster holistic wellness offerings; cosmetic formulators integrate them for skin-nourishing benefits; food and beverage innovators explore anecdotal flavor profiles; homecare products leverage aroma and antimicrobial properties; perfumers craft signature scent compositions; pharmaceutical researchers investigate novel therapeutic applications.
Distribution channel segmentation reflects the coexistence of traditional and digital pathways. Offline presence through pharmacies and specialty retail remains foundational for established brands, while supermarkets and hypermarkets drive broader consumer access. Online channels via branded websites and e-commerce platforms deliver personalized omnichannel journeys, enabling traceability, direct consumer engagement, and richer data-driven marketing strategies.
Unearthing Regional Variations and Growth Trajectories in the Global Sandalwood Arena
Regional dynamics in the sandalwood market showcase distinctive patterns. In the Americas, strong consumer affinity for wellness and natural personal care has spurred demand for certified, sustainably sourced oils and extracts. Brands are emphasizing ethical credentials to resonate with conscientious buyers, while niche growers in Latin America explore plantation ventures to bolster regional self-sufficiency.Across Europe, Middle East and Africa, stringent biodiversity regulations and endangered species protections have influenced import quotas and certification protocols. European markets lead in adopting digital traceability and eco-labeling, aligning sandalwood derivatives with clean beauty and luxury sustainability narratives. In Gulf Cooperation Council countries, high-purity oils sustain their status as cultural staples, and African producer nations are expanding plantation development to meet global demand while fostering local economic growth.
The Asia-Pacific region remains the heart of sandalwood cultivation, with established operations in South Asia complemented by emerging plantations in Southeast and East Asia. Production-centric initiatives prioritize ecological restoration and yield optimization. Meanwhile, consumer markets in East Asia are embracing sandalwood-infused skincare and aromatic products, driving innovation in localized formulations that blend traditional practices with contemporary wellness trends.
